DOJ Agents Deployed to ICE Facilities Amid Rising Violence

UPDATE: In a significant escalation, Attorney General Pam Bondi has just announced the deployment of agents from the Department of Justice (DOJ) to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) facilities across the United States. This urgent move comes as violence against federal agents intensifies, following a tragic shooting at a Dallas ICE field office that left one detainee dead and two others critically injured.

Bondi stated, “At my direction, I am deploying DOJ agents to ICE facilities—and wherever ICE comes under siege—to safeguard federal agents, protect federal property, and immediately arrest all individuals engaged in any federal crime.” This announcement, made on June 30, 2023, underscores the escalating tensions surrounding immigration enforcement.

The DOJ’s actions aim to counter a series of violent incidents, including at least four attacks on ICE and Border Patrol locations in Texas this year. The latest deployment seeks to bolster security in the face of mounting threats and acts of domestic terrorism aimed at federal agents. Bondi emphasized the urgency of the situation, directing Joint Terrorism Task Forces nationwide to disrupt and investigate all entities involved in such acts.

In the past few months, protests against ICE have surged, reflecting the deepening divide over immigration policies. A notable incident occurred in May, when Democratic lawmakers clashed with Department of Homeland Security officers at an ICE facility in Newark, New Jersey. During this event, Mayor Ras Baraka was arrested after tensions flared.

Earlier this summer, the Trump administration also mobilized National Guard troops to assist ICE in response to ongoing unrest. The stakes have only grown higher, with incidents ranging from tear gas deployments in California to confrontations with political figures at protests. Just last week, a Democratic mayor running for Congress in Illinois was teargassed during a small protest outside an ICE facility.

These developments highlight the urgent need for federal protection of ICE operations as the country grapples with contentious immigration policies. The DOJ’s commitment to pursuing the most serious charges against participants in these “criminal mobs” signals an increasingly aggressive stance from federal authorities.
